How to Take Wrinkles Out of Polyester With Steam

Although strong, versatile and in many cases less expensive than cotton, the synthetic material polyester does have one downfall: its inability to withstand direct heat. This can make it difficult to iron out the wrinkles from your polyester pants, top or dress without leaving behind an unsightly scorch mark.

How To Make Heels Look Nice With Fat Ankles

Women with large calves or big ankles can slim their look by wearing high-heeled shoes. The right heel style can elongate the legs and minimize the size of your ankles. You should avoid shoes that have an ankle strap; this shoe type will draw attention to your ankles.

What Body Type for a Drop-Waist Dress?

The drop-waist dress is a classic style, often associated with the 1920s. These dresses are relaxed and comfortable but work best on specific body types. Drop-waist dresses typically fit loosely from shoulder to hip, transitioning into a pleated or gathered skirt at the hip, rather than the natural waistline.
